James died in December 1891, buried in Torryburn churchyard. Margaret died in 1900 aged 89 years.
Various back-up documents visible here: http://www.themastertons.org/genealogy_tng/getperson.php?personID=I9&tree=culross
William Masterton, brother of James, died in 1877 in Perth. Margaret Wynd, his wife, had died in 1850.
